Ticket: Canary gating rules bypass possible via manual promote

For security review: the Oakmark deploy pipeline's canary gate can be skipped when an operator triggers a manual promote while the health-check window is still open. This lets unvetted builds reach full rollout without the anomaly scan completing. Proposed fix requires gate attestation before promote unlocks. The affected build is identified by the token below.

session token of kageg-tahop = htk14_af3c1ccccb7dcf

Subject: Quickstore 4.2 — bloom filter now fronts the KV layer

Plugin authors: starting with this release, Quickstore places a bloom filter ahead of the key-value store. Negative lookups return faster; false positives fall through safely. No API changes are required on your side. Verify your plugin against the staging build referenced below.

session token of fahif-tadup = htk3_9c7

## Further Reading

Quick context for the sync: Pebblegate now sits behind a bloom filter to cut pointless disk lookups on the Karst KV store. False-positive rate is tuned to 0.7%; membership checks are rebuilt nightly. Sizing math, rebuild cadence, and the shard-level stats live on the Karst team's internal reference page.

wiki page, tahaf-tajog: https://jira.ordindyn.corp/pipeline